How does the equipment work? In patch 1.2, which is supposed to be released in December, the watermark system will be revised. This is a special system in New World that remembers what the strongest drop has been so far:

  • The longer you go without receiving a drop with a higher gear score, the higher the chance of an upgrade.
  • However, once that happens, you initially receive weaker gear until you get lucky again and reach the next watermark.
  • The watermark can only be increased through drops and chests. Equipped gear, regardless of its level, does not impact it.
  • From December on, you will be able to see exactly in your inventory how high your watermark is, which will also carry the name “expertise” from then on.

So far, this system has only affected drops. If you directly obtain an item with a gear score of 600 through crafting or the trading post, you immediately have a max item. But that is exactly what is supposed to change in 2022.

What does the change look like? As the developer Zin_Ramu revealed in the forum, expertise will in the future have an impact on the strength of your equipment, regardless of the gear score:

In the December update, expertise will determine the highest drops you can receive per slot, similar to how it was with the watermark system. But starting in early 2022, it [the expertise] will also determine the effectiveness of your equipment. This means, if your Warhammer expertise is 520 and you equip a Warhammer with a gear score of 550, the effective gear score of the weapon will be reduced to 520.

While we understand that this may lead to a temporary decrease in strength for some players, we believe that it will ultimately lead to a more rewarding progression loop that cannot be bypassed by purchasing gear at the trading post.

How does the game mode play? The game mode Rush is best understood as a smaller version of Breakthrough. Instead of 128 players, 32 players (16 per team) compete against each other. This takes place on a smaller version of the gigantic maps.

There is a defending team and an attacking team. The attackers try to plant bombs in individual sectors to be allowed to attack the next part of the map. If they fail to do this for the entire map, the defenders win.

This game mode in Battlefield Portal excites fans

Rush first appeared in this form in Battlefield: Bad Company 2. The mode was an instant hit back then. Therefore, Bad Company 2 Rush is also a standard game mode for Battlefield Portal’s version of Bad Company 2. Now, Rush is also available for the maps from Battlefield 2042.

Patch fixes annoying snakes and nerfs popular class

This is particularly well received: The Grab vipers in the Halls of Vaught (Nihlathak’s Temple, Act V) now deal poison damage instead of physical damage with their clouds. This change brings relief to many players.

The reactions range from: “Can’t wait for my minions to stop dying” to: “Is the torment finally over?” Previously, there was another bug with the vipers that caused them to deal damage far more frequently than intended.

Why was this so important? The halls are a popular farming spot for magic items. However, the vipers have caused difficulties for all players, as they could easily annihilate characters as well as minions and mercenaries.

Due to the excessive damage inflicted, almost everything was destroyed by the clouds. Additionally, physical damage can only be reduced by up to 50%. Poison damage can be reduced by up to 95%.

What’s changing for the Sorceress? The update also altered the effectiveness of the Sorceress, one of the 7 classes in Diablo 2. A bug was corrected, which caused stacked Firewall spells to deal more damage than intended.

This bug was, according to players, a way to make more builds playable. Due to the “nerf,” it has become more difficult to kill bosses like Baal (via reddit.com). However, corresponding builds are not completely unplayable because of this.

What’s up with classes in Lost Ark? It’s a bit complicated:

  • In the current Korean version of Lost Ark, there are 6 different base classes and 22 “Advanced Classes” – these are the classes that you will “actually play.” For example, there are 4 different variants of the Warrior.
  • This also has to do with the “Genderlock”: While we in Europe have a “Warrior” that can be played as a woman or a man without changing the gameplay, MMORPG developers in South Korea would create two different classes that resemble each other but differ slightly in gameplay.
  • At the launch in Europe and North America, Lost Ark will start with 15 of the 22 classes. The 15 classes are not evenly distributed among the 6 main classes: there are about 4 different variants of the Martial Artist, but only 2 Wizards and no “Specialist.” The selection of classes has now been changed.

What’s included in the update? The big December update is expected to be titled 1.2 and will make some changes to the endgame:

  • High-Watermark will now be referred to as “Skill” and will be displayed for each piece of equipment in the inventory, so players can track their progress. However, the display will only appear at level 60.
  • There will be two new endgame points where players can fight against enemies of level 66. These are located in Edenhain and at the Imperial Palace.
  • Bosses in the “Garden of Origin” and “Lazarus Instrumentality” expeditions will guaranteed additional skills, and there is also a chance from chests.
  • A new resource “Gypsum” will be introduced. With this, you can take impressions of your equipment. This provides you with an item for that equipment slot and gives a boost to your “Skill”. Gypsum can be obtained, among other things, from bosses, expeditions, in outpost rush, and during corruption events.

There will also be new content for crafting fans. Anyone who has reached level 200 in a Life Skill will be able to fill up ascension circles with excess XP. Each filled circle provides containers with useful items or blueprints. Additionally, you can see how often you have improved beyond level 200.

Furthermore, new equipment schematics will be introduced in crafting. This will allow you to more easily guarantee access to equipment with a gear score of 600.

Adjustments to balance in PvP – December 2021

What changes in PvP? There will also be some adjustments to PvP in December:

  • The damage formula in PvP will be revised so that the actual armor value is calculated instead of an average when a character of a lower level fights against a strong enemy. As compensation, the damage dealt by players of a lower level will be increased.
  • Bonuses on critical damage will now work additively instead of multiplicatively.
  • There are adjustments to the buffers for abilities, dodging, and light attacks. This small change could potentially have significant effects on the game, depending on how abilities and the dodge role can now be interrupted.

What are hitboxes? Hitboxes describe an invisible area on a character that helps better calculate collision or hit detection. Without these invisible areas, you wouldn’t be able to inflict damage on your opponents.

Every body part of your Guardian is equipped with a box. So when you land a shot, Destiny 2 registers this request and distributes the damage assigned to that hit with the selected weapon.

However, it can happen that hitboxes register damage that couldn’t have occurred at all.

What happened? Actually, the questline around “Gespalten im Alterctal” was supposed to start only with the launch of the expansion on December 7. However, the latest hotfix has activated the questline now, allowing all players to start working on earning the necessary honor.

How do you earn honor? You earn honor in various modes after choosing between the Horde or Alliance. This prompt automatically occurs when starting the game and is determined by whether you select Vanndar (Alliance) or Drek’thar (Horde) as a card.

Then, you receive honor for each completed match in these game modes:

  • Traditional Hearthstone
  • Arena
  • Duels

How much honor is there? That depends on how well you perform in the matches and which enemies you face. The basic rule is:

  • Each match gives 10 honor – even in a loss
  • A win gives an additional 10 honor (total 20)
  • A win against an enemy of the other faction gives an additional 20 honor (total 40)

In the best case, you can receive 40 honor per match when you win against a player of the opposing faction.

How much honor is needed? That fundamentally depends on which rewards you want to earn. If you want to snag all the rewards, you will need to collect a proud total of 7,200 honor.

In the worst case, it means that you may need to lose a whopping 720 games to unlock the final card of the questline. In the best case, you would only need to win 180 games if you faced a player who chose the other faction every single time.

Since it is highly unlikely to win 180 games that are played against the opposing faction or to lose 720 games in a row, the outcome will ultimately lie somewhere in the middle.

What rewards are there? In total, there are 13 golden cards (via playhearthstone.com) that can be earned through the honor questline. The first card is already available after 40 honor, but the amount increases rapidly. The highlight, however, are the final cards, for which a total of 7,200 honor must be collected. Alliance players receive a golden Drek’Thar, while Horde supporters receive the golden Vanndar Stormpike. So each gets the card they initially snubbed at the start of the event.

However, the questline will remain available until the end of the expansion, which lasts just under four months. Basically, this makes it a “second reward path” where players can earn even more cards than are available in the standard reward path present with every expansion.

However, you should not underestimate the grind for this task. If you want to spread the workload over the approximately 120 days of the expansion, you need to complete between 1.5 and 6 matches per day. A considerable amount for a game that is often played “on the side”.

That’s why Halo won this battle: It’s not easy to compare the three games based on pure data. CoD Vanguard is only available on Battle.net, for example. There are no user scores there, as on Steam. However, it is found on Metacritic.

Battlefield 2042 and Halo Infinite are both available on Steam, but also run on other launchers like the Xbox PC Hub or EA’s Origin launcher. There are no reviews there either.

Nevertheless, comparisons can certainly be made:

  • Battlefield 2042 received around 63,000 reviews on Steam – of which only 35% are positive (via Steam). On Metacritic, it received scores between 64 and 69 points from critics, with a user score ranging from 2.2 to 3.0. (via Metacritic)
  • CoD Vanguard scored between 72 and 74 points on Metacritic, with a user score ranging from 3.5 to 5.1. (via Metacritic)
  • Halo Infinite has only clear data on Steam. Here, over 89,000 players have rated the free-to-play shooter. The game holds 80% positive reviews. (via Steam)

Regarding players, Halo Infinite is thus clearly ahead of CoD and Battlefield. There is no statistic for Metacritic yet since the game officially releases on December 8.

But player numbers also indicate: Halo Infinite is significantly ahead of Battlefield 2042 and has been able to retain its players better since release.

  • While Battlefield 2042 started with over 100,000 concurrent players, numbers have steadily declined over the past few weeks. Now, the game reaches a maximum of about 30,000 concurrent players per day. It has thus lost 70% of its players in just a few weeks.
  • Halo Infinite has remained relatively stable and has nearly hit the 100,000 mark daily since release. In the first weeks, numbers even rose above 200,000 players.
  • Although Halo is a F2P title, it becomes even more significant that so many Steam players who paid for Battlefield 2042 have already lost interest.
